He was extremely critical of the practice of Christianity as a state religion, primarily that of the Church of Denmark. His psychological work explored the emotions and feelings of individuals when faced with life choices.

from shakespeare to existentialism

Kierkegaard's early work was written under the various pseudonyms to present distinctive viewpoints that interact in complex dialogue. He wrote many Upbuilding Discourses under his own name and dedicated them to the "single individual" who might want to discover the meaning of his works.

Christianity teaches that the way is to become subjective, to become a subject. Some of Kierkegaard's key ideas include the concept of " subjective and objective truths ", the knight of faiththe recollection and repetition dichotomyangstthe infinite qualitative distinctionfaith as a passionand the three stages on life's way. Kierkegaard wrote in Danish and the reception of his work was initially limited to Scandinaviabut by the turn of the 20th century his writings were translated into French, German, and other major European languages.
